1. Hand Tied Bouquet Design
Competition format
Video and photo shooting
  • All entries must be based on natural plants and flowers
  • All flowers cannot be trimmed in advance and must be trimmed on site
  • Contestants are required to prepare all kinds of flower materials and tools required for flower arrangement according to their designs, such as: flower materials, flower mud, flower utensils, water, auxiliary materials, watering cans and pruning tools
  • Participants are required to provide a “Work Information Sheet”, which includes
    i. Title of work
    ii. Creative concept and feature description (within 100 words)
    iii. Use of flowers and symbolic messages
    iv. Explanation of references or quotations from other people’s works in the work (if any)
  • Participants are free to choose to bring their works to the site for display and communication
 Grading rubric
  • Theme creativity 20%
  • Colour matching 20%
  • Techniques 20%
  • Overall Appereance 20%
  • Public Review (scored by cross-sector review) 20%
Video requirements
  • Video the contestants’ self-introduction and contestant number
  • Highlights of beginning
  • Highlights of the mid-stage operation
  • Effect display of the final finished product
  • The entire video should not exceed 10 minutes
